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's) about Histo Biopsy Small

Histo biopsy test, or histology, is a medical procedure that involves the examination of tissues and cells under a microscope. The goal of the Histo biopsy test is to identify abnormalities in tissue samples and diagnose various conditions such as cancer or other diseases.

 

In general, most biopsy histology tests typically take between 24 and 72 hours to process and analyze. However, some cases may require more specialized testing or consultation with other specialists which can delay results further.

 

Histology plays an essential role in identifying the stage and grade of tumors. By examining tissue samples from biopsies, pathologists can determine how aggressive the cancer is and what kind of treatment is necessary for optimal results.

 

The results of Histo biopsy tests are typically given in the form of a pathology report. The report will include details on what was found during the examination as well as any recommendations for further testing or treatment.

 

One of the most commonly used methods for histology is the Hematoxylin and Eosin (H&E) staining method. The H&E staining method involves using a combination of two dyes, hematoxylin and eosin, to stain different parts of cells in tissue samples. 

 

One important factor to consider is cell differentiation. Tumor cells are often less differentiated than normal cells, meaning they have lost some characteristics specific to their tissue type. This can be seen under a microscope as abnormal nuclear shapes and sizes.

 

One of the most commonly used instruments in this field is a microscope. A powerful and high-quality microscope allows pathologists to observe the cellular structures of tissues at an incredibly detailed level.

 

Tissue collection is one of the most critical aspects of this process, as it ensures that samples are viable and representative of the affected area. By using specialized instruments and techniques to extract tissue from tumors or other abnormal growths, pathologists can analyze samples in detail to identify any abnormalities or irregularities.
